History of the Marietta Fire Museum
Situated in a historic fire station, the Marietta Fire Museum acts as a dedication to the evolution of firefighting in the region. Established in 2002, the museum emerged from a community effort to preserve local firefighting history and honor the dedication of firefighters. The building itself, dating back to the early 20th century, showcases the architectural design of its era and previously served as an operational station for the Marietta Fire Department.
Throughout the years, the museum has expanded its mission to teach visitors about fire safety and the vital role of firefighting. It displays artifacts, photographs, and memorabilia that record the advancements in firefighting technology and techniques. The museum's devotion to protecting this history has made it an important resource for both locals and tourists. By offering insight into the difficulties and triumphs encountered by firefighters, the Marietta Fire Museum stands as a significant cultural landmark in the community.

Classic Fire Engines
Even though fire engines have evolved considerably over the years, the Marietta Fire Museum takes pride in displaying a outstanding collection of historic fire engines that showcase the rich heritage of firefighting. Visitors can explore various models dating back to the late 19th century, including horse-pulled steam pumpers and early motorized fire trucks. Each piece in the collection shares a history, highlighting innovations in technology and design while emphasizing the dedication of firefighters throughout history. The museum also features rare examples, such as a beautifully restored 1920s fire engine, which reflects the essence of its era. This collection not only serves as an educational resource but also stirs nostalgia and admiration for the brave individuals who extinguished flames with these iconic machines.
Exceptional Treasures Exhibition
In addition to the impressive collection of historic fire engines, the Marietta Fire Museum presents a unique display of artifacts that deepens the narrative of firefighting history. Among these artifacts are vintage firefighting tools, including hand pumps and hoses, which show the evolution of firefighting techniques. The museum also showcases uniforms worn by firefighters through the decades, providing insights into the changing standards of safety and design. Furthermore, original photographs capture the bravery and camaraderie of local fire crews, preserving the stories behind each image. Notably, memorabilia from significant fires in Marietta's history connects visitors to pivotal moments in the community's past. This well-curated collection serves to educate and inspire, celebrating the heroes who have devoted their lives to fire safety.

Value of Fire Safety
Though numerous people might overlook the significance of fire safety education, it plays a critical role in protecting lives and property. Proper fire safety education provides individuals with necessary knowledge about fire mitigation, identification of hazards, and proper response techniques during emergencies. By learning the principles of fire safety, communities can substantially reduce the risk of fire-related incidents. Learning fosters awareness about the critical nature of smoke alarms, fire escapes, and evacuation plans, guaranteeing that families are more thoroughly prepared in case of an emergency. Furthermore, including fire safety education into community programs can foster a culture of safety, empowering citizens to take precautionary measures. Ultimately, dedicating funds in fire safety education is vital for securing both lives and important assets from the catastrophic effects of fire.
